Hi:
Yahoo has had to revise its term of service. Can we agree to live with
these and leave our website where it already is? I need answers by
Saturday since they will be deleting our website on Monday.
These are the new terms of service (at least the part that was of concern):
7. CONTENT SUBMITTED TO YAHOO GEOCITIES
Yahoo does not claim ownership of the Content you place on your
Yahoo GeoCities Site. By submitting Content to Yahoo for inclusion on your
Yahoo GeoCities Site, you grant Yahoo the world-wide, royalty-free, and
non-exclusive license to reproduce, modify, adapt and publish the Content
solely for the purpose of displaying, distributing and promoting your Yahoo
GeoCities Site on Yahoo's Internet properties. This license exists only for
as long as you continue to be a Yahoo GeoCities homesteader and shall be
terminated at the time your Yahoo GeoCities Site is terminated.
I, for one, sure like these terms better!
